Samenvatting

This is a book comprising selected papers of colleagues and friends of Heinrich Begehr on the occasion of his 80th birthday. It aims at being a tribute to the excellent achievements of Heinrich Begehr in complex analysis and complex differential equations, and especially to his prominent role as one of the creators and long-time leader of the International Society for Analysis, its Applications and Computation (ISAAC).
